We offer software development services for all stages of the Software Development Lifecycle. Depending on the size of your software development needs, we are able to utilise local (Sydney based) and offshore resources through our partner DashSoft. This provides you with a local team for regular meetings, requirements gathering and general customer facing work in your time zone, as well as the capabilities of our development partner offshore.
Technical Capabilities
-
Microsoft .NET Development - C#, ASP.NET, VB.NET, Web Services
-
Microsoft SQL Server – Database Administration and Development, including Reporting Services, Analysis Services and Integration Services components
-
Sybase Adaptive Server – Database Administration and Development
-
Microsoft Office – database integration and task automation
Development Approach
To ensure the best outcome for clients, we follow an iterative approached to system development.
The preparation of a project scope is the first phase of any development work. The main objective here to ensure requirements and expectations are clearly defined. The scope document will generally include an outline of system requirements, the technology that will be utilised, approach taken to develop the system, how the system will be implemented, and time and cost estimates.
Depending on the size of the project, we often split the development phase into smaller deliverables for your early feedback and validation of business and technical requirements. Often called an agile methodology, functionality is added in short succession, rather than having to wait until final completion for all functionality.
During implementation, we can provide training, online user guides (such as in HTML help format) and full system documentation if required for hand over to your operations staff. We can also provide ongoing maintenance and support services.
Platform
Our computing infrastructure means that you can completely outsource all development work to us, freeing you of the need to invest and configure in hardware and software and the on-going maintenance and support of such infrastructure.
However should you prefer that work be performed on your premises (Sydney area only), either partly or entirely, we can also provide our own equipment with all the software development tools required. Our server and desktop environment is primarily Windows based.
We use Microsoft Visual Studio and other software development tool sets. If you have a specific requirement to match your computing platform, contact us. All development work is backed up to Network Attached Storage by our managed data centre. For version control we use TFS, which allows us to manage all aspects of the software development life cycle and collaborate with our offshore development team.
Availability
We have resources available for short to longer term development work. Our rates are quoted in Australian dollars (AUD) and given exchange rates, can be quite competitive. Should you wish to discuss your software development or consulting needs, please contact us.